So what’s the process like?

Like I mentioned before, we shoot film, strictly film, no digital or high definition video. We are not your typical wedding videographers.  This is not some political stance against HD, in fact there are rumors we will be adding HD to our repertoire in 2013.   In any case, Kodak Film is still our medium of choice;)  The organic nature of film helps create an imaginative and nostalgic experience for the subject and the viewer.  The sound of the cameras alone, while shooting, is enough to cause anyone within hearing distance to have an immediate flashback. The complete process is pretty simple and yet completely handcrafted.  We shoot a variety of vintage cameras, have the film digitally ranked or do some dirty telecine ourselves, soundtrack the film, edit the film, and deliver on web and dvd. How do you soundtrack the film?

We are often inspired by the day, the raw footage, the feel, or the vibe of the couple.  Many hours are spent on crafting just the right soundtrack.  Those hours are usually spent listening to LP, after 45, after LP, after 45, and so on.  Yes we still listen to vinyl.  It is a huge creative influence of ours and the bone structure to our soundtracks.

What about voice over / sound sync?

Yes we can do it!  Special moments throughout the day can be recorded as sound bits and added as creative edits and sound overlays to any motion picture.

Do I get all the raw footage?

Sorry, you do not.  And trust us, you wouldn’t want it all (but if you do, let’s talk).  Film is precious!  Unlike digital video where you can just keep rolling and rolling, switch out a card and keep rolling some more, Super 8 and 16mm has strategically sought out, planned, and often creatively directed shots.  Yes we will capture the natural, intimate, and candid moments of your day (and do our best to be in more than one spot at one time while doing so) but the reality is that we are a small team and we keep it that way with your best interests in mind.  For larger wedding parties and extended films we will bring in extra cinematographers to help capture as much of your day as possible.
